There is nothing on the refuileng floor that would cause such an explosion. I would bet money that the explosion was caused by a hydrogen leak in the turbine building. Large generators are cooled with hydrogen. The turbine building is not built to maintain its function in a earth quake. The upper portion of the reactor building above refuileng floor is just an industrial sheet metal construction and not designed to withstand an explosive pressure wave because it was not required at the time (late 60s).
